|
You have Bar Code Modifier specified as X'02" which means you want the Check Digit to be calculated The Y is the Check Digit If you are calculating the Check Digit and it is 5 Then you want the modified value to be Hex'01' John -----Original Message----- From: midrange-l-bounces@xxxxxxxxxxxx [mailto:midrange-l-bounces@xxxxxxxxxxxx] On Behalf Of Bonnie Lokenvitz Sent: Thursday, September 28, 2006 5:08 PM To: Midrange Systems Technical Discussion Subject: Barcode 3of9 question I have printer file and RPGLE program that prints four 3of9 bar codes. Each field is defined as alpha and the DDS keyword looks like this: BARCODE(CODE3OF9 3 *HRITOP X'02') All look OK except the one that is a generated number with a check digit that is moved to a sixteen-character field for the masking. Value 4851-36500004-5, where the last 5 is the check digit, prints as 4851-36500004-5Y This is AFPDS not IPDS. Do you have any idea what I have done wrong? Thank you, Bonnie Lokenvitz Technology Consulting Inc 320.679.2599
As an Amazon Associate we earn from qualifying purchases.
This mailing list archive is Copyright 1997-2024 by midrange.com and David Gibbs as a compilation work. Use of the archive is restricted to research of a business or technical nature. Any other uses are prohibited. Full details are available on our policy page. If you have questions about this, please contact [javascript protected email address].
Operating expenses for this site are earned using the Amazon Associate program and Google Adsense.